How often aircon filter need changing?
spidermike007 replied to giddyup's topic in Thailand Motor Discussion
Never. Most have a fine filter that is easy to access, and only needs to be rinsed with a shower head, or toilet spray gun. It should be done every 2 weeks, or else you are subjecting yourself to a higher level of particulate matter than you need to. Also, have an AC guy take the whole thing apart every 6 months for a deep cleaning, and have him check the freon. Basic maintenance. Your AC will thank you for it. -
